Before commencing <br />the work, the Engineer will furnish to the City a certificate or certificates in form satisfactory to <br />the City (See Attachment D for example), showing that the Engineer has complied with this <br />paragraph. Before commencing the work and within five (5) business days of the City's award <br />of a contract, the Engineer must deliver to the City a certificate(s) of insurance evidencing that <br />such policies are in full force and effect. Failure to meet the stated insurance requirements and <br />provide the required certificate(s) and any necessary endorsements within five business days <br />may cause the contract to be terminated. The City reserves the right to obtain complete, <br />certified copies of all required insurance policies at any time. The stated limits of insurance <br />required by this Paragraph are minimum only - -they do not limit the Engineer's indemnity <br />obligation, and it will be the Engineer's responsibility to determine what limits are adequate. <br />These limits may be met by basic policy limits or any combination of basic limits and umbrella <br />limits. The City's acceptance of certificates of insurance that do not comply with these <br />requirements in any respect does not release the Engineer from compliance with these <br />requirements. The kinds and amounts of insurance required are as follows: <br />1) Workers' Compensation Insurance and /or Employer's Liability Insurance: In <br />accordance with the provisions of the Workers' Compensation Act of the State of Texas <br />and /or $500,000.00 1$500,000.00 for Employer's Liability. <br />2) Commercial General Liability Liability Insurance: (1) Commercial general liability <br />insurance with a combined single limit of $1,000,000 for each occurrence and $1,000,000 in <br />the aggregate, Engineer agrees to maintain a standard ISO version Commercial General <br />Liability occurrence form, or its equivalent providing coverage for, but not limited to, Bodily <br />Injury and Property Damage, Premises /Operations, Products /Completed Operations, <br />Independent Contractors. <br />3) Business Automobile Liability Insurance. — Limits of liability not less than $1,000,000.00 <br />per occurrence. The Engineer agrees to maintain a standard ISO version Business <br />Automobile Liability, or its equivalent, providing coverage for all owned, non -owned and <br />hired automobiles. Should the Engineer not own any automobiles, the business auto liability <br />requirement will be amended to allow the Engineer to agree to maintain only Hired and Non - <br />Owned Auto Liability. This amended coverage requirement may be satisfied by way of <br />endorsement to the Commercial General Liability, or separate Business Auto policy. <br />4) Professional Liability Insurance. — Limit of liability not less than $1,000,000 per claim. <br />Engineer agrees to maintain Professional (Errors & Omissions) Liability to pay on behalf of <br />the insured all sums which the insured will become legally obligated to pay as damages by <br />reason of any negligent act, malpractice, error or omission of the Engineer or any person <br />employed or acting on the Engineer's behalf (including but not limited to sub - contractors). <br />Engineer agrees to maintain a retroactive date prior to or equal to the effective date of this <br />contract and that continuous coverage will be maintained or a supplemental extended <br />reporting period will be purchased with a minimum reporting period not less than two years <br />after the completion of this Agreement. The Engineer is solely responsible for any additional <br />premium to maintain coverage or if coverage is not maintained for the supplemental <br />extended reporting period. <br />
